The Turing Pi 2 puts 4 Raspberry Pi CM4s on a mini ITX board. But how do they perform? Can a little Pi supercomputer make the Top500 list? Find out all that and more!

So... lets math this out. Turing Pi 2 Mobo, $200, $10x4 Pi CM4 Adapter boards, power supply $30-$50, Case $0-$200 CM4 boards x4 $35-$85 depending on where you get them and what version you get, we'll say another $100 - $150 on the low end for SD cards / or SSDs etc. Looking at a little cluster in a box for $500 to $700. Fairly expensive but considering the learning potential and the small size and flexibility, actually rather cheap. Totally worth it for all that you can learn on it, basically a homelab in a box.

@d.barnette2687 2 жыл бұрын
Parallel computing with overset grids for computational fluid dynamics is a great reason for clusters. By dividing huge grids that won't fit on one node (memory wise) into much smaller subgrids each fitting on one of many nodes, very large CFD problems can be run. NASA has been doing this for decades but with much larger and much more expensive computers. This was how the flow field around the space shuttle was computed back in the '80s.
